Pulling a Bed in Macau Streets

Pic: in front of Macau Marine Museum

Last nightfall, if you happened to see such a scene in crowded Macau streets’s peak hour - a gal trolleying hard a bamboo bed on right side w/ a guy on the left side, a funny rare thing for today's auto- world ‒ don’t laugh, it's me and my pulling-bed partner.

I walked and pulled the new bed i bought w/him for 25 minuntes across streets, alleys, car-flowing roads until finally climbing up the slope top where i live. Ouch, all sweat!

The arrangement w/ the shop's shi tou po (lady boss) when I booked w/ deposit was that i paid extra money for hire a van for delivery. But then when i went there, this mid-age thin shop clerk put the bed on a trolley, I guessed he was taking it out to the main street for loading to van.

"No, i myself pull it to your place." He said.
"What? So heavy and so long way?" I couldn’t believe.

But they said No van available and the lady boss also not available for me. I wanted to pay a taxi or asked for friend's car but the bed too large to fit.

Cunning shi tou po! First, I walked behind and the guy pulled. Sooner, w/ his back bending down, I couldn’t let him alone and offered one hand for the pull. Then came the scene in the beginning.

I kept chatting w/ my pull-bed partner on the way. He did not complain. He looked happy when I joined him. He said he needed the job while looking for a better one, so whatever the boss asks him, he’d do it. For some narrow and up-turning path, he needed to pull it alone while I watched behind his thin arching back.

“To make a living is not easy.” He concluded. I agreed.

I enjoyed the laboring and sweating. But I felt sorry/angry for the shop owner’s trick. She meant to charge me van fee but spare it and abused her skinny clerk worker ‘s manpower. Capitalist thinking? To squeeze every drop of sweat and blood out of the workers? Or Chinese business way to save every coin out of the dealings?

Being cynical, I asked the clerk to dial the shop, I told the lady that I would only pay the balance amount for bed price excluding the van cost. My voice was calm, but hers was cold, “I don’t know who you are.” Wrong connection? We dialed again, the same “I don’t know who you are.”, but wait, “you can take a taxi yourself.” She pointed out my stupidity.

Ouch, was this the hot lady that received me? Anyway, I paid more to my pull-bed partner and asked him to keep it for himself and tell the boss this just did not pay according to bill.

“If she presses you, ask her come here to take back her bed.” I said.

Sure, if she comes tomorrow, I’ve slept on this lovely bamboo bed for one night.

Sure, she will never come to me.

(Yet sometimes I doubt whether I react too much due to my fighting genes. What do you think?)
